reopen 23443

The proposed solution, which has to bind syntax-propertize-function to nil before calling scan-sexp, reads like a work around. These things shouldn't be necessary.

Assume a fix must affect usage of syntax-propertize-function and probably is 
not a trivial one.
Its design seems worth further discussion.

For example reading:

"The specified function may call ‘syntax-ppss’ on any position
before END, but it should not call ‘syntax-ppss-flush-cache’,
which means that it should not call ‘syntax-ppss’ on some
position and later modify the buffer on some earlier position."
